• ABOUT MERC

    The Mining Emergency Response Competition (MERC) provides a valuable opportunity for Emergency Response teams from resource industry companies, to demonstrate their skills through a competition across a range of Emergency Response scenarios.

    Participating teams will be demonstrating their training, expertise and professionalism and at the same time bring recognition to the wider community of the value and importance of Emergency Response and Rescue training. This will continue ensuring safe workplaces and communities in the event of emergencies.

    MERC 2011

    The inaugural MERC was held on 3rd & 4th of December 2011 at the Burswood Park grounds.It was an industry wide event with fourteen teams from W.A. participating in seven main events; First Aid, Firefighting & BA Skills, Vehicle Extrication, Hazchem & BA Skills, Confined Space & BA Skills, Rope Rescue and ERT Readiness. The event was also accompanied by an opening cocktail evening and a closing dinner in the main Burswood Ballroom. The MERC committee are proud to announce that the event raised over $45,594 for Miners Promise (www.minerspromise.org.au), a charitable organisation assisting families and individuals who are confronted with the death or permanent disability of a family member employed in the rtesource sector. We thank each and every one of our sponsors, teams and volunteers for their hard work and enthusiasm in achieving this amount.

    • OUR CHARITY

      MINERS PROMISE
      Established on 1 July 2010, Miners' Promise is the only independent not-for-profit legacy scheme created to support workers and their families after the death or significant injury of a loved one employed within the resources industry of Western Australia.

      Miners' Promise is more than just a financial benefit, though – it is very much a comfort at the time of greatest need. It is mateship in it's most practical and useful form. It's mates looking after mates. Miners Promise is open to all employees of participating companies or sponsors within the resources sector of WA – you don't need to be working on a mine site to join. You can be working at a desk or contracted to the sector and still contribute to, and benefit from Miners Promise.
